Anatoli Ivanovich Dovzhenko was born in 1932 in Dnipro (Dnepropetrovsk), Ukraine. He studied at the Dnepropetrovsk Art College in 1948-53 and at the Kiev Art Institute in 1953-59. He worked in Vinnytsia (big Ukrainian regional centre) and was a member of the Ukrainian Artists' Union. Works by Dovzhenko are displayed in the Museum of Vinnytsia and other public collections.
